Emporia High wrapped up a 2-7 football season in the first year of Daniel Goodman. The squad had numerous All-Centennial League performers.
The Spartans were led on the first team by Jose Vargas. The senior made it on offense and defense as a guard and defensive tackle.
Three defenders and one offensive player made second team. Defensive back Oliver Kline, defensive linemen Ben Collins, and linebacker Brody Telfer each had a standout season for Emporia. On offense, the red and black relied on running back Rylan Crowell.
Terrick Franklin (DL), Jonathon Couch (OL), and Garrett LeBlanc (DB) all placed Honorable Mention.
The Spartans were eliminated in the first round of the playoffs by Hutchinson.
